Product details
SRR1280 Series Magnetically Shielded Wire Wound Inductors
Bourns SRR1280 Series SMD Shielded Power Inductors with a low profile of only 7.5mm. Applications include input/output of DC/DC converters and power supplies for: Portable communication equipment; Camcorders; LCD TVs; Car radios
High current rating
Ideal for high frequencies
